Red Interactive Agency

I was looking through the websites at CSSRemix and happened to glance at one with ff0000.com as the domain name. I would have never thought to use hex values as a domain name but someone else has! Anyway, the name of the company is Red Interactive Agency. They specialize in web development and online marketing among other things. The coolest thing about their site though is the chat feature they’ve provided. You are first given a generic username as well as a random character which can both be changed when you familiarize yourself with website. The setting is like an old, ancient graveyard that the users can travel by foot OR they can fly into the vastness of space. Of course, there’s a point where you can’t go any further.

I’ve never really seen a design firm who can keep people on their websites for a long amount of time.
